A story about seven dogs escaping from a dog meat restaurant in Changchun, Jilin Province, northeastern China, has sparked global sympathy. However, new facts have revealed unexpected details about the escape. It turned out that the female German Shepherd was in heat, which attracted the other dogs to follow her.
The story began when a passerby filmed a video showing the seven dogs walking together along the roadside, which garnered widespread attention on social media. The video was widely circulated, with many believing that the dogs had escaped from their inevitable fate at a dog meat restaurant, making them a symbol of freedom and courage.
Details of the Event
The rapidly spreading video showed the dogs walking together, leading many to believe that there was a heroic story behind this escape. However, after investigations by local media and some official entities, it was revealed that the shepherd dog was in heat, which naturally attracted the other dogs to follow her.
This twist in the events elicited mixed reactions from the public, with some feeling disappointed due to the absence of a heroic escape story, while others considered that the story still held a humane aspect, as the dogs were seeking safety and companionship.
Background & Context
The phenomenon of selling dog meat is a controversial topic in China, with opinions varying widely. While some consider it a cultural tradition, others see it as a violation of animal rights. In recent years, there has been an increase in awareness regarding animal rights, leading to growing calls for a ban on such practices.
In 2020, the Yulin Dog Meat Festival was organized, which sparked widespread protests from animal rights activists, resulting in changes to some local policies. However, this issue continues to represent a significant challenge within Chinese society.
